Injury forces Tommy Haas retirement

Former world number two Tommy Haas was forced to withdraw midway through his first-round Australian Open clash with Guillermo Garcia-Lopez earlier today.

The German decided that he was unable to continue through the pain of a shoulder injury.

He retired while trailing his Spanish opponent by one set and 5-2 in the second.
